Excel MCP: 自動讀取、提煉、分析 Excel 數據並生成可視化圖表和分析報告
最近,一款 Excel MCP Server 的開源工具火了,看起來功能很強大,咱們今天來一探究竟。
基礎環境
Python 3.10 or higher Python 3.10或更高版本
# 需要提前安裝uv
pip istall uv
安裝 MCP SERVER
下載服務包
git clone https://github.com/haris-musa/excel-mcp-server.git
創建虛擬環境
cd excel-mcp-server
uv venv excel-python-env
激活虛擬環境
excel-python-env\Scripts\activate
或者
call excel-python-env\Scripts\activate.bat
安裝依賴
uv pip install -e .
退出虛擬環境
excel-python-env\Scripts\deactivate.bat
運行 MCP 服務器
uv run excel-mcp-server
自定義端口方式運行:
# Bash/Linux/macOS
export FASTMCP_PORT=8080 && uv run excel-mcp-server
# Windows PowerShell
$env:FASTMCP_PORT = "8080"; uv run excel-mcp-server
Cursor/Cline/Trae 配置參考
將這個配置添加到你的編輯器中吧。
{
"mcpServers": {
"excel": {
"url": "http://localhost:8000/sse",
"env": {
"EXCEL_FILES_PATH": "你的目錄"
}
}
}
}
這裏以 Trae 爲例:
最後的效果
腳本啓動後,這裏看到可使用或者亮綠燈的情況就可以使用了。
演示案例
案例 1:
創建一個Excel文件
案例 2:
從抖音上找到20位AI的博主,並對博主進行分析(博主名稱、作品特色、鏈接等方面拆解)),分析後的結果存入表格中.
遺憾的是他搜索的結果不夠多,這沒關係,我們其實可以再安裝幾個關於搜索的 MCP 就可以得到更全的結果了,後續咱們會更新這款的例子。因爲這些搜索的 MCP 需要 key,使用納米 AI 的可以免費使用。
案例 3:
分析一下這份週報,以可視化圖標顯示 2024年-xxx項目週報-0706.xlsx ,輸出形式爲html
過於簡單了,不知道是不是自己的提示詞不夠準確導致的。
本文由 Readfog 進行 AMP 轉碼,版權歸原作者所有。
來源:https://mp.weixin.qq.com/s/MpXc5Lh4z2iOdAKUHc1iHA